Transaction 66f787c070b00d867ba3e4f7ffaed60b2e64c81c30abbe51c8cbb96a730fa843

3 Input
2 Outputs
  • 66f787c070b00d867ba3e4f7ffaed60b2e64c81c30abbe51c8cbb96a730fa843:0
  • value  788744449
    address  12vRZHmrX1j6Sp3kCvHQGi8f4KaiKWvr4F
  • 66f787c070b00d867ba3e4f7ffaed60b2e64c81c30abbe51c8cbb96a730fa843:1
  • value  127699
    address  1FQdRVSG83qnSYBBRy4S28NKoFAMAynZQX